Factors to Consider When Choosing an Ethernet Cable
When selecting an Ethernet cable for your router, there are several factors to consider:
Category
Ethernet cables are classified into categories based on their performance capabilities. Higher-category cables support faster data rates and better signal quality. For most home and office networks, a Cat5e or Cat6 cable is sufficient. However, if you require high-speed connections, a Cat6a or Cat7 cable is recommended.
Shielding
Shielding protects the Ethernet cable from electromagnetic interference (EMI), which can disrupt data transmission. Shielded cables are recommended for environments where there is a high risk of EMI, such as industrial settings or areas with multiple electrical devices.
Length
The length of the Ethernet cable is important because longer cables can introduce signal degradation. Choose a cable that is the appropriate length for the distance between your router and the device you are connecting.
Brand Reputation
When purchasing an Ethernet cable, opt for a reputable brand that adheres to industry standards. Low-quality cables from unknown brands may not meet specifications and compromise network performance.
